Student and academic promos expand access to Copilot.

Microsoft has extended its student promotions to cover more regions and academic domains. Originally limited to U.S.-based .edu emails, the free three-month Copilot Pro access now includes students in the United Kingdom through verified .ac.uk accounts.

The promo remains limited to one redemption per student ID and must be activated before 30 September 2025. After the trial ends, the subscription automatically converts to the standard pricing tier.



Copilot Pro trials focus on mobile-first users.

The Copilot Pro mobile trial has become a central part of Microsoft’s onboarding strategy. The 30-day free period is available on iOS and Android, unlocking enhanced reasoning models, longer context handling, and faster response times.

However, after the trial expires, billing starts automatically at $20/month unless manually canceled. Availability varies by country, with India and Brazil excluded from this offer due to regional licensing constraints.


Copilot Studio trials bring customization to personal users.

Microsoft has relaxed restrictions for Copilot Studio, its low-code automation platform that integrates workflows with private data. As of the latest update, personal Microsoft accounts can now enroll in the 30-day free trial, which was previously limited to Entra ID (corporate) accounts.

This makes it easier for individuals and small teams to test workflow orchestration, function calling, and private integrations without requiring enterprise credentials.


Enterprise discounts encourage early adoption of Copilot.

Organizations using Microsoft 365 E3/E5 plans can now access a 15% discount on Copilot seat add-ons, provided the contract is signed before 31 December 2025.

The promo covers up to 2,400 licenses per tenant and includes priority onboarding support through Microsoft’s enterprise partner network.
